Join The Harlem Biospace Digital Disruption Discussion In Healthcare At Columbia University

NYC-based companies are leveraging algorithms and data to change the way people think about their health. From diagnosis to research to patient-provider engagement, digital technology is making its way into all parts of the healthcare ecosystem. Join Harlem Biospace as we bring speakers from three leading companies on stage, and discuss the trends and future of the evolving healthcare system.
